Studies of combined quadruple vaccines against diphtheria, pertussis, tetanus, and typhoid fever: reactogenicity and antigenicity.

B Cvjetanovic, D Ikić, W R Lane, T Manhalter, S Tapa.   

Abstract

Different DPT + typhoid vaccines were produced by two laboratories and tested in the field for untoward local or systemic reactions and in the laboratory for immunogenic properties. The combined DPT and acetone-inactivated and dried typhoid antigen was found to cause more numerous and more severe local and systemic reactions than the DPT and DPT + typhoid (heat-thiomersal) vaccines. The antibody responses to all four antigens in both of the combined DPT + typhoid vaccines were very satisfactory.From the results of these studies it is concluded that quadruple DPT + typhoid vaccine is suitable for use in areas where typhoid fever is a problem and where logistic and other considerations require the use of combined vaccines.
